Direct impact of London bombing on July 7th in North America was decline
in the rider-ship on the transit system in New York, Chicago,
Philadelphia, Toronto and other places. On July 8th, crowd in the Toronto
subway system was unusually thin. I know this for a fact as my family and
I take this transit system everyday in the morning. Usually it is packed
with standing room only. But a day after 7/7, it was another story. The
rider-ship did not return to its usual, until about four days. Then the
second attempt to disrupt life in London took place on 21/7. This time the
rider-ship did not drop. People in Toronto had taken a cue from the
Londoners. Toronto riders returned to the transit system with thumbs down
at the terrorists. This story was repeated in the other cities in North
America also. Net result, the terrorists did not gain their objective i.e.
disruption of life by scaring the population with death and destruction.
It was quite unlike 9/11. Days following the 9/11, life in New York and
other cities did not return to normal for a while. In the end, what the
terrorist gained out of 7/7 was the displeasure of a very hospitable
people in the Europe and North America. Hospitable in the sense that four
million Muslims live in England, another ten million live in continental
Europe and five million live in North America. All the above live or work
and preach with practically no hindrance. Then one may ask why would
anybody in his right mind, bomb the very system which is vital to the
prosperous existence of them and everybody else?
Politically, this is the worst move the Osma Bin Laden and his henchmen
have made. For some reasons, Madrid bombing did not result in excessive
displeasure in Europe or America. London Bombing has earned them the wrath
and anger of everybody.

US Congress in days following the 7/7 bombings and attempted bombing on
21/7 passed the provisions of the Patriot Act, which had come for renewal.
The Patriot Act is the toughened US attitude after 9/11. Prior to the 7/7,
there was a muttering noise by the civil libertarians in US to repeal some
of the strictest provisions of the Patriot Act. This liberal’s opposition
vanished after London bombing and the passage of the renewal of the
Patriot Act was made easy in the Congress. Canada has not undertaken any
changes to its excessively liberal policies. But, for how long Canada can
postpone it. The transit system in Canada is as vulnerable to these
attacks as any such system in Europe and US. After all Osma Bin Laden and
his henchmen have declared Canada as one of the states which is to be
targeted for acts of violence. If Canada does not grab these anti-social
elements now, then they will not mind targeting Canada.
